Does Part D cover semaglutide?

Asked by: Hassan Anderson  |  Last update: February 6, 2025
Score: 4.5/5 (18 votes)

In March 2024, Medicare announced that Part D plans could cover semaglutide (Wegovy; Novo Nordisk) for patients with elevated body mass index ([BMI]; BMI ≥ 27 kg/m²) and established cardiovascular disease (CVD), regardless of their diabetes status.

Is semaglutide the same as Ozempic?

Ozempic, known generically as semaglutide, was approved in 2017 by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for use in adults with type 2 diabetes. Ozempic is a weekly injection that helps lower blood sugar by helping the pancreas make more insulin.

How much weight can you lose in 3 months with Wegovy?

Wegovy patients tend to lose around 4% body weight after two months, 6% after three months, and 8% after four months. After 17 months you can expect to lose around 15% of your starting body weight.

Why do I feel so bad on semaglutide?

Because semaglutide slows down the digestive process, it can cause gastrointestinal side effects that you might not be used to. Some of the most common side effects of semaglutide include: Nausea. Vomiting.
